Cut tow isosceles triangles two feet back from one side of the plywood. This will leave a point on one end. Put the two cut-off triangles to form a second point on the other end.

I make cabinet cases and boxes and to best use a sheet of plywood I’ll make a paper template to scale and take the shapes I need and arrange them to minimize waste. Comes in real handy when you need to match grain.

Well, a lot depends on how you want the layout to be configured in your space, so there’s no single answer. For example, to stretch it out along two walls with loops at each end, it could be something like this:
If you can’t get a larger view to work, try this link
You just flip one piece (D) over for this configuration.
That’s for a solid table-top, assuming that you use additional dimensional wood (1X4, etc.) for the framing and legs or brackets from the wall.
